(build-shlib): Pass -O1 down to linker to get optimized shared
authordrepper <drepper>
Wed, 25 Nov 1998 15:41:08 +0000 (15:41 +0000)
committerdrepper <drepper>
Wed, 25 Nov 1998 15:41:08 +0000 (15:41 +0000)
libraries.

Makerules

index c18a569..b40362e 100644 (file)
--- a/Makerules
+++ b/Makerules
@@ -359,7 +359,7 @@ lib%.so: lib%_pic.a $(+preinit) $(+postinit) $(+interp)
        $(build-shlib)
 
 define build-shlib
-$(LINK.o) -shared -O -o $@ $(sysdep-LDFLAGS) $(config-LDFLAGS)  \
+$(LINK.o) -shared -Wl,-O1 -o $@ $(sysdep-LDFLAGS) $(config-LDFLAGS)  \
          -B$(csu-objpfx) $(load-map-file) \
          -Wl,-soname=lib$(libprefix)$(@F:lib%.so=%).so$($(@F)-version) \
          $(LDFLAGS.so) $(LDFLAGS-$(@F:lib%.so=%).so) \